Courteney Cox Calls “Cougar Town” Her “Saving Grace”
It’s no secret that she’s been weathering some tough times since splitting with David Arquette, and Courteney Cox is taking refuge in her work.
During a recent interview, the former “Friends” babe confessed that her hit television show is helping her cope with her personal life.
She confessed, “Thank God for this show. There have been times when [executive producer] Bill [Lawrence] has asked, ‘Do we need to take a break?’ And I was, ‘Are you kidding?’ This is my saving grace.”
As for the constant media attention, Courteney shared, “I think I am kind of used to it. But, I think, as I get older, I am more sensitive, so it might be harder in some ways. Also, because I love this show so much, I feel so thankful. I do take personally anything involved with this show. Also, my life is so crazy right now, so I am getting a lot of that. It is probably a little harder than it used to be. I think I didn't notice. Bill [Lawrence] says that I am on the Internet all the time. I am not. I actually barely know how to get on the Internet. I do care about the reviews of the show. I don't go searching too hard because I don't know how to find it.”
